      Charting research on international luxury marketing: where are we now and where should we go next?

          Abstract

          Purpose

          Despite luxury's increasing globalization and broadening scope via digitalization and new markets, the intellectual structure of the overall research corpus remains tenuous. This work therefore aims to provide an overview of published work on international luxury marketing and to contribute to a better understanding of the research area.

          Design/methodology/approach

          Using a systematic approach, 1151 items (papers) were retrieved and 181 selected from the international luxury marketing field published before 2019. These items were analyzed by using various bibliometric techniques to identify the most productive countries, journals, influential authors, papers and research clusters.

          Findings

          Although most of the outputs originate from business, management and marketing journals, other disciplines also research this topic. The analysis reveals an emerging field, with 85% of the published papers appearing between 2010 and 2018, which are primarily the output of US- and UK-based authors and none of whom dominates the field. The three identified keyword clusters are (1) consumers and consumption (2) tools and (3) core themes.

          Practical implications

          This article contributes to our understanding of the evolution, current status and research trends of published research on international luxury marketing by presenting a mapping analysis and proposing future research directions.

          Originality/value

          This is the first bibliometric mapping analysis of research on the topic from its conception to 2019. It contributes insights from different research disciplines, adds to the categorization of the international luxury marketing literature and provides promising future research directions in terms of research areas and strategies.

          Software survey: VOSviewer, a computer program for bibliometric mapping

          We present VOSviewer, a freely available computer program that we have developed for constructing and viewing bibliometric maps. Unlike most computer programs that are used for bibliometric mapping, VOSviewer pays special attention to the graphical representation of bibliometric maps. The functionality of VOSviewer is especially useful for displaying large bibliometric maps in an easy-to-interpret way. The paper consists of three parts. In the first part, an overview of VOSviewer’s functionality for displaying bibliometric maps is provided. In the second part, the technical implementation of specific parts of the program is discussed. Finally, in the third part, VOSviewer’s ability to handle large maps is demonstrated by using the program to construct and display a co-citation map of 5,000 major scientific journals.
